Output 81ea2081af9a768b5991b052ab017ea78a68222a16d1b0cee4a78ae0e96e26ac:2

value
3546720
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b1ec132079a84bcf6daeb8d8b49a060e30dc947 OP_EQUAL
address
35d1pfVCKH5GjZAWK7o13rH2671EunjWdq
transaction
81ea2081af9a768b5991b052ab017ea78a68222a16d1b0cee4a78ae0e96e26ac
confirmations
226923
spent
true